在SQL Server中,删除数据表的方法是使用DROP TABLE
语句。具体格式如下:,,``sql,DROP TABLE 表名;,
``
在SQL Server中,删除数据表通常指的是移除表中的所有数据或者彻底删除整个表结构,以下是具体的步骤和方法:
创新互联建站主要从事网站建设、成都网站制作、网页设计、企业做网站、公司建网站等业务。立足成都服务海门,十载网站建设经验,价格优惠、服务专业,欢迎来电咨询建站服务:028-86922220
删除表中的数据
要删除表中的数据,可以使用DELETE
或TRUNCATE
语句。
使用 DELETE
语句
DELETE
语句用于删除表中的行,并可在删除时加上条件限制,其基本语法如下:
DELETE FROM <表名> WHERE <条件>;
如果省略WHERE
子句,将删除表中的所有行,需要注意的是,DELETE
语句会逐行删除数据,并且会触发表中定义的任何DELETE触发器。
使用 TRUNCATE
语句
TRUNCATE
语句用于快速删除表中的所有行,并重置表的标识(IDENTITY)列到初始值(如果有),其基本语法如下:
TRUNCATE TABLE <表名>;
TRUNCATE
不会触发DELETE触发器,并且通常比DELETE
操作更快,因为它不记录单个行删除的日志。
删除整个表结构
如果想要完全删除一个表,包括它的结构和所有数据,可以使用DROP
语句。
使用 DROP
语句
DROP
语句用于从数据库中删除一个表的定义及其所有数据,基本语法如下:
DROP TABLE <表名>;
执行该语句后,表及其数据将从数据库中彻底消失,请谨慎使用此命令,因为一旦表被删除,所有数据都将无法恢复。
小结
下表归纳了上述方法的主要特点:
操作 | 关键字 | 描述 | 是否可逆 |
删除部分数据 | DELETE | 逐行删除,可以加条件;触发DELETE触发器 | 是 |
删除全部数据 | TRUNCATE | 快速清空表数据,不触发DELETE触发器,重置标识列 | 否 |
删除表结构及数据 | DROP | 删除整个表和所有数据,不可恢复 | 否 |
注意事项:在进行删除操作前,建议先备份相关数据以防不测,特别是在生产环境中,如果是删除整个表结构及数据,确保已经确认不再需要该表及其数据。
当前名称:sqlserver删除数据表的方法是什么
URL标题:http://www.shufengxianlan.com/qtweb/news46/72596.html
网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联